Seen here in revised BMA colours, G-AXLL was sold to Transbrasil in May 1973 as PP-SDT. After service with Faucett as OB-R-1173 it returned to the UK at the end of 1983 for BCal. Sold by BA to European Aircharter in February 1985, it went to Savannah Airlines as 5N-BDU in November 2001 but was damaged beyond repair in a storm at Abuja in March 2002 and was scrapped there in 2013 This photo is copyright © Richard Vandervord, and may not be used or published in any way without permission.
